why is the heart heaviest when empty?
the soul is blackest when surrounded by light
why is the rose most beautiful, when laid in debris?
why is the moon it`s brightest, in the darkest night?

they say all stars burn out, vanish into the depths of time
when will the sun cease to shine upon our decreasingly green earth?
the trees are becoming something of a dreamlike state to me, sublime
perhaps a single seed will float into the sea of eternity, to give the gift of birth

how did my life come to be?
was i merely a creation of lust?
i think i`d have to disagree
i`d like to think of it as trust.
